Marry me is about Kat Valdez, A popular pop star who is about to marry her fiance, Bastian (Maluma ). As a promotion of her single titled Marry me. Kat is about to marry her fiance in the middle of her concert. Things didn’t go well her way because she found out that her man is cheating on her with her assistant. The affair got filmed on video and it went viral online. Broken-hearted by the betrayal, She decided to marry a random guy in the audience carrying a sign with the words Marry me. His name is Charlie Gilbert (Owen Wilson.) He is not even a fan, he is a single dad who brought his daughter to the concert. This is her way of saving face from the humiliation of Batian’s affair. Charlie is unable to say no because he realizes that declining will humiliate her worst. Being the gentleman that he is, he decided to marry her.

Marry me is based from a Webcomic of the same title. They just made some changes like the character’s names and age.
Kat will try to make her marriage with Charlie because she wanted to prove the media wrong. She became a center of Joke by entertainment media so she will try to fake a happy marriage with Charlie. The play pretend will eventually spark a real romance but their separate worlds will try to split them up. Marry me will come to theaters this coming February 11, 2022.
